Praia do Meco is a popular surf beach on Portugal’s central coast, south of Lisbon, near Sesimbra and about an hour from the city. It’s a long, open Atlantic beach with plenty of space, natural scenery, and a laid-back local vibe.
Surf characteristics
- Wave type: Mostly beach break
- Best for: Beginners to intermediate surfers, depending on swell size
- Conditions: Can offer fun, clean peaks with moderate swells; bigger swells can make it stronger and more challenging
- Wind/swell: Works best with offshore or light winds and a decent Atlantic swell
Beach & atmosphere
- Wide sandy beach with a more wild, natural feel than urban Lisbon beaches
- Less crowded than many central surf spots, especially outside peak summer
- Scenic cliffs and a relaxed beach culture
- Known for its calm, spacious setting and sunsets
Good to know
- Parking and access are generally straightforward, but it can get busy on weekends and during good swell
- Conditions can change quickly due to the Atlantic exposure
- Water is cooler, so a wetsuit is usually needed most of the year
Overall
Praia do Meco is a solid surf spot if you want a beautiful, easygoing beach with workable waves close to Lisbon. It’s especially good when you’re looking for a less urban surf experience and don’t mind a beach break that varies with the swell.
